Page History
...
Note |
---|
Dec 19 is our final meeting of 2019. We will not meet on Thursday Dec 26 or Thursday, Jan 2. Our next DSpace 7 Working Group (2016-2023) meeting will be on Thursday, Jan 9. |
Agenda
(15 mins) Developer Stand Up - Developers give brief updates on their effort (or their team's effort).
- Update/see "Current Work" section below based on your status. Please feel free to update prior to meeting.
- Please highlight any new work (needing reviews/testing), any blockers (for you), and any discussion topics you may have.
- (30 mins) General Discussion Topics
- Updated DSpace 7 Release Plan Spreadsheet
- "Release" column lists approximately what remaining features will be in 7.0beta1-5, along with those likely delayed for 7.1 or 7.2
- As of 2020, we will be working towards the beta1 / beta2 releases via "sprints". Goal for beta1 is in Feb, with beta2 in March.
- (Other Topics?)
- Updated DSpace 7 Release Plan Spreadsheet
- (15 mins) Planning for next week
- Assigning PRs for Review
...
- (Angular) Adding Accessibility via Travis CI https://github.com/DSpace/dspace-angular/pull/356 (work in progress) (Lower priority)
(Angular Bug) https://github.com/DSpace/dspace-angular/issues/368 ( Art Lowel (Atmire) )
- (REST Contract) Edit Homepage news: https://github.com/DSpace/Rest7Contract/pull/45 (Ben Bosman - has outstanding questions/comments) (Lower priority)
- (REST) DS-4043: Revisit the security layer of the submission (work in progress) Andrea Bollini (4Science)
- (REST) Pagination bug with withdrawn items: https://github.com/DSpace/DSpace/pull/2406 (Dimitris Pierrakos , Ben Bosman - Feedback provided)
- (REST) Update to JDK 11: https://github.com/DSpace/DSpace/pull/2611(REST) Projections continued: https://github.com/DSpace/DSpace/pull/2625
PRs Needing Review
- (REST Contract) Group and eperson management: https://github.com/DSpace/Rest7Contract/pull/41 (Tim Donohue - feedback provided, Andrea Bollini (4Science) -
feedback provided)
- (REST Contract) Workflow actions (update) https://github.com/DSpace/Rest7Contract/pull/96
(Tim Donohue, NEEDS SECOND REVIEWER)Status colour Blue title 1 approval - (REST) REST endpoint for discovering withdrawn and private items. https://github.com/DSpace/DSpace/pull/2580 (Tim Donohue - REREVIEW
, Ben Bosman
)
- (REST) DS-4389 improving patch system framework Part 1 https://github.com/DSpace/DSpace/pull/2591 (Andrea Bollini (4Science), Tim Donohue - REREVIEW, Michael Spalti )
- (REST) Initial Implementation of Resource Policies endpoint: https://github.com/DSpace/DSpace/pull/2604 (Ben Bosman - feedback provided, Tim Donohue - REREVIEW, Andrea Bollini (4Science))
- (REST) Small Bitstore fix to work correctly with multiple stores: https://github.com/DSpace/DSpace/pull/2597
(Mark H. WoodStatus colour Blue title 1 approval , Tim Donohue ) MERGE
- (REST) [DS 4287] Refactoring the IndexableObject & SolrServiceImpl https://github.com/DSpace/DSpace/pull/2612 (Ben Bosman - feedback provided, Tim Donohue - FINISH REVIEW)
- (REST) Ds DS-4351 upgrade dependencies https://github.com/DSpace/DSpace/pull/2619 (Tim Donohue, Chris Wilper)
- (NEW) (REST) Projections continued: https://github.com/DSpace/DSpace/pull/2625 (Ben Bosman, Tim Donohue)
- (NEW) (Angular) Projections continued (merge with REST PR 2625): https://github.com/DSpace/dspace-angular/pull/548
(Art Lowel (Atmire), Tim Donohue)Status colour Blue title 1 approval - (Angular) Shibboleth integration support: https://github.com/DSpace/dspace-angular/pull/429 (Giuseppe Digilio (4Science) reviewed again fixed error with yarn start, Fernando FCT/FCCN, Paulo Graça - feedback provided)
- (Angular) Edit collection - content source tab https://github.com/DSpace/dspace-angular/pull/506
(Paulo Graça - issues found, Tim Donohue )Status colour Blue title 1 approval - (Angular) Add/Edit Community and Collection Logos https://github.com/DSpace/dspace-angular/pull/512 (Art Lowel (Atmire)
, Tim Donohue -
tested again, works but has usability issues - will log as bugs)
- (NEW) (Angular) Upgrade to angular 7 https://github.com/DSpace/dspace-angular/pull/547 (Art Lowel (Atmire) , Tim Donohue)
- (NEW) (Angular) Disregard the response body for statistic event calls https://github.com/DSpace/dspace-angular/pull/544 (Tim Donohue
, Paulo Graça )
- (Backend) dspace.bat file: https://github.com/DSpace/DSpace/pull/2544
(Tim Donohue -Status colour Blue title 1 approval Verified on Windows. One minor change needed, Mark H. Wood , Alexander Sulfrian, Chris Wilper , Andrea Bollini (4Science) -
verified on linux)
- (Backend) [DS-4393] Discovery clean index fix https://github.com/DSpace/DSpace/pull/2607
(Paulo Graça, Ben BosmanStatus colour Blue title 1 approval ) MERGE
- (NEW) (Backend) [DS-4239] Migrate the workflow.xml to spring https://github.com/DSpace/DSpace/pull/2420 (Ben Bosman, Tim Donohue)
PRs Merged this week!
first PR goes here
...
Overview
Content Tools